Mark-Henry Jakobsoo is a cybersecurity specialist at RaulWalter, focused on operational security, monitoring, and the practical implementation of information security controls. He brings a strong technical foundation combined with a calm, problem-solving mindset and a clear sense of responsibility — qualities that are essential in security-critical environments.

Mark has hands-on experience in security operations gained through his work at a national critical infrastructure operator. His work has included vulnerability monitoring, deployment and configuration of cybersecurity tools, log analysis, incident investigation, and security configuration documentation. He has written detection rules (SIGMA), AppLocker policies, and developed security monitoring dashboards using the ELK stack, as well as performed threat emulation and phishing analysis.

In parallel, Mark has worked in IT user support roles, collaborating closely with different teams, handling incident triage in Jira, administering Active Directory and Azure environments, and maintaining operational documentation. This background gives him a strong understanding of how security controls interact with real-world IT operations and user workflows.

Academically, Mark is pursuing a bachelor’s degree in Cybersecurity Technologies at Tallinn University of Technology, where he has achieved a high academic standing. His knowledge base covers E-ITS, ISO 27001, GDPR fundamentals, risk analysis, network technologies, cloud environments, infrastructure-as-code, and both Linux and Windows operating systems. He has complemented his studies with internationally recognised training, including the Google Cybersecurity Certificate and CCNA Enterprise Networking.

At RaulWalter, Mark contributes to cybersecurity projects that require precise execution, reliable monitoring, and strong alignment with standards such as E-ITS.
